What began as an installation in London has now blossomed into a lovely book (which you can order online right here), covering Gamper's project in full detail---chair by chair. So why the sudden urge to create 100 chairs? ‘There is no perfect chair," Gamper once said, as he decided to deconstruct chairs from discarded and donated piles to create new chairs with already existing elements. Working with materials ranging from pipe dresses to go-karts, the result is a collection of 100 unique, hand-crafted creations that are [nearly] too pretty to sit upon. Amazing. P.S.
